The Monsoon Slouchiness

                                                                 

                                                                 

                                                        

                                                       

                              

Although our part of the world stands rain deprived, the scorching heat and rising humidity calls for some comfort slouchy dressing. I feel, cotton and linen trousers/pants are an ultimate staple for this season, more for their weather friendliness than the style quotient they impart to the whole look. While khakis and whites  find a permanent place in the closet, I was tempted to try linen in colour. Luckily, the wonderful guys at b:kind sent me a pair in cheerful yellow which not only is a statement piece in itself but also the smile to be worn during the gloomy, rainy days ahead. Rather than going in for a T-shirt or a crop-top, with this look I tried my hand at some summer layering. I opted for a textured net wrap over a nude lace camisole which like these pants kept the whole look light and breezy. Nude pumps and minimal accessories finished the look, much so reflecting my mood for all things simple, stark and minimal.

Magic Can Sometimes Be Just An Illusion

                                                                               

                                                                        

                                                                    

                                                                        

                                                                        

                                                                             

From high-waisted and retro to slim and neat, skirt is that one garment in your closet that offers the greatest variety of options. From pencil and A-Line skirts for office wear to the mini, midi and maxi route for the happy hours, skirts are a multi-faceted piece of clothing. What I personally love about skirts is their ability to stand out on their own and at the same time blend with the top/blouse/shirt/T-Shirt of your choice and lend the outfit feel of a complete dress.
Skirts - maxis and midis - are having a major fashion moment, but the new entrant to the universe has been the sheer trend. The 'Illusion Skirt' as it is being called popularly, finds a comfortable balance between sexy and elegant. While I found favourites in this and this when it came down to adding one in The TrimmingsAndLace Collection, I couldn't escape my inherent sense of choosing lace (how I love you). The styling with this outfit has been very simple and muted. While the floral shirt (last worn here) provides minimal degrees of colour, the embellished sling bag adds texture to the entire outfit. I preferred the jewellery to be in the same colour tone as the rest of the outfit, so as to let the skirt shine unperturbed.

The Sky's Blue - For Me And You


                                                                             

                                                                            

                                                                               

                                                                          



I quite enjoy the idea of an impromptu outfit shoot. For first it helps me answer the hovering question as a YES that I do wear these outfits in my everyday life. Second, it helps me put to test my not-planned, not-tried-before outfit ideas. Beyond that, a reason to wear florals...Really?? I believe as much as we might want to categorize, 'Florals' can hardly be confined to a particular fashion season. While bold, large floral prints welcome as into spring, soft flora provides respite from the scorching summers. Florals cast in deep hues suggest the autumn festivities while in winters florals magically work to cheer us up on a foggy day, reminding that the dewy spring is just around the bend. Whatever be the season's color palette or silhouette of choice there can never be any escaping the high-octane dose of floral power. 
On the side, blogging is helping me re-discover my fashion sensibilities. Like, I cannot miss out on adding a feminine touch into my regular style. I added that tinge of petiteness to this otherwise casual look with my earrings. Further, I love to go statement. Thus, with spring worn so boldly on my sleeves I kept the look basic by pairing it with mutes. Finally, a belt clinched to the waist to structure this flowy top.
